Costs of Antarctica Expedition Cruises

Antarctica expedition cruises are a dream for many adventure seekers, but the costs can vary significantly depending on a variety of factors. Let’s break down the typical costs involved and explore what factors can affect the overall expense of such a unique journey.

Breakdown of Costs

When considering the costs of Antarctica expedition cruises, it’s essential to factor in the following expenses:

  • Base cruise fare
  • Airfare to and from departure point
  • Excursions and activities
  • Travel insurance
  • Gratuities

Comparison of Pricing

Different expedition companies offer varying pricing structures for Antarctica cruises. Factors that can influence pricing include:

  • Vessel type and amenities
  • Duration of the cruise
  • Level of luxury and comfort
  • Inclusions such as meals, excursions, and equipment

Factors Affecting Overall Cost

Several factors can impact the overall cost of an Antarctica expedition cruise, including:

  • Time of year: Peak season cruises may be more expensive
  • Cabin type: Suites or premium cabins come at a higher price
  • Itinerary: Longer or more extensive routes may cost more
  • Add-on experiences: Optional activities can increase the overall cost

Itineraries of Antarctica Expedition Cruises

Antarctica expedition cruises offer unique itineraries that allow travelers to explore the stunning beauty of the Antarctic region. These cruises typically follow common routes, visiting key destinations while providing a range of exciting activities for passengers to enjoy.

Common Routes

Antarctica expedition cruises often depart from Ushuaia, Argentina, and cross the Drake Passage before reaching the Antarctic Peninsula. Along the way, passengers may also visit the South Shetland Islands, Deception Island, and other remote locations in the region.

Key Destinations

– Antarctic Peninsula: Passengers can explore breathtaking landscapes, visit research stations, and observe wildlife such as penguins, seals, and whales.
– South Shetland Islands: These islands are known for their rich biodiversity and stunning scenery, offering opportunities for hiking, kayaking, and wildlife viewing.
– Deception Island: A volcanic island with a unique landscape, where passengers can soak in hot springs and explore abandoned whaling stations.

Duration of Typical Expeditions

Antarctica expedition cruises usually last between 10 to 20 days, depending on the specific itinerary and activities included. Longer expeditions may offer more in-depth exploration of the region and additional opportunities for wildlife encounters and adventure activities.

What to Expect on an Antarctica Expedition Cruise

When embarking on an Antarctica expedition cruise, it is essential to have a good understanding of what your daily schedule might look like, the weather conditions you are likely to encounter, and some valuable tips for first-time cruisers.

Typical Daily Schedule

During an Antarctica expedition cruise, your daily schedule will be filled with exciting activities and educational opportunities. A typical day may include zodiac cruises to explore icebergs and wildlife, shore landings to observe penguins and seals up close, and onboard lectures from expert guides.

  • Morning: After breakfast, you may head out for a zodiac cruise or a shore landing to start your day with wildlife sightings.
  • Afternoon: In the afternoon, you might attend lectures or workshops to learn more about the unique ecosystem of Antarctica.
  • Evening: The evenings are usually reserved for socializing with fellow passengers, enjoying a delicious meal, and reflecting on the day’s adventures.

Weather Conditions in Antarctica

Antarctica is known for its unpredictable weather conditions, with temperatures often hovering around freezing. It is essential to pack multiple layers of warm clothing, including waterproof gear, to stay comfortable during your expedition. Be prepared for strong winds and potential snowfall, even in the summer months.

Tip: Be sure to pack plenty of sunscreen and sunglasses to protect yourself from the intense Antarctic sun, which can cause sunburn even on overcast days.

Tips for First-Time Cruisers

For first-time cruisers to Antarctica, it is crucial to be prepared for a once-in-a-lifetime adventure. Here are some tips to help you make the most of your expedition:

  • Stay flexible: Weather conditions in Antarctica can change rapidly, so be prepared for schedule adjustments to maximize your wildlife sightings.
  • Bring a good camera: You’ll want to capture the stunning landscapes and incredible wildlife you encounter, so make sure to pack a quality camera with extra batteries and memory cards.
  • Stay hydrated: The dry Antarctic air can be dehydrating, so be sure to drink plenty of water throughout the day.
  • Respect wildlife: Remember to keep a safe distance from wildlife to avoid disturbing their natural behavior and habitat.
